Text-historical research

In Toronto, Frances Garrett, Khenpo Kunga Sherab, and Dakpa Gyatso have been studying Tibetan language guidebooks to hidden lands (sbas yul). An international workshop on “Hidden Lands in Himalayan Myth and History: Transformations of Beyul (sBas yul) through Time” was held in Toronto in December 2017, featuring thirteen paper presentations; this research is now being prepared as an edited volume.

In Sikkim, Anna Balikci-Denjongpa is working with monks from Pemayangtse monastery on a book that documents sacred sites in the Khangchendzonga National Park and the environs.
